Southern Independent Group Demanded UN to Stop Mass Punishment Exercised by Legitimacy Government Against the Southern People

[su_label type=”info”]SMA News – Geneva – Exclusive[/su_label][su_spacer size=”10″][su_dropcap]T[/su_dropcap]he Southern Independent Group condemned mass punishment policies exercised by some wings of Yemeni legitimacy government against the southern people as these wings ordered the stop of civil services in Aden as punishment for being involved in the public uprising against the government’s corruption and killing of peaceful demonstrators in addition to attacking martyrs’ funerals.
The group indicated that Minister of Interior Affairs froze the ministry’s work in Aden in serious violation and escalation against civilians. They indicated that this illegal act should be dealt with by UN and Gulf States to remove this disqualified minister.
The group demanded UN and other international organizations to assume their humanitarian responsibilities towards the southern people and to exercise pressure over the government to stop this mass punishment and reconsider the legitimacy of this government. In addition, the group demanded UN to provide the Southern Transitional Council with international legitimacy and to ban mass punishment according to article 33 of Geneva Fourth Convention that bans mass punishment.
